Levobetaxolol Ophthalmic Dosage

Usual Adult Dose for Glaucoma (Open Angle)
Instill 1 drop in the affected eye(s) twice daily.

Precautions
Remove contact lenses before administration and wait at least 15 minutes before reinserting them.
Wait at least 5 minutes before instilling other eyedrops.
